The church of Jesus Christ as of September 23, 2009 is one and the same with the church birthed on the day of Pentecost: “There is one body, and one Spirit, even as ye are called in one hope of your calling” (Ephesians 4:4). Therefore their can only be one foundation which has already been laid.
This foundation has its roots in the Old Covenant starting with Moses and ending with Malachi, true prophets who faithfully proclaimed the coming of Christ. You must remember that at the time Paul wrote this , the scriptures that he referred to was the Old Covenant—the New Covenant was still being written. Make no mistake about it: The prophet’s Ephesians 2:20 is referring to is Moses, David, Isaiah, Jeremiah and others. These are prophets that passed the test of Deuteronomy 18:20-22:
“But the prophet, which shall presume to speak a word in my name, which I have not commanded him to speak, or that shall speak in the name of other gods, even that prophet shall die. And if thou say in thine heart, How shall we know the word which the LORD hath not spoken? When a prophet speaketh in the name of the LORD, if the thing follow not, nor come to pass, that is the thing which the LORD hath not spoken, but the prophet hath spoken it presumptuously: thou shalt not be afraid of him.”
How is it that most of the “modern prophets” of our time have failed this test miserably and yet are still proclaimed as true prophets? They readily admit that they have spoken lies from time to time but it is now under “grace.” Isn’t it amazing that they want the authority of a prophet but not the accountability.
“Oh, but you don’t understand, there are signs and wonders done by these men, this proves that they are of God!” Listen to what Deuteronomy 13:1-3 says, “ If there arise among you a prophet, or a dreamer of dreams, and giveth thee a sign or a wonder, AND THE SIGN OR THE WONDER COME TO PASS, whereof he spake unto thee, saying, Let us go after other gods, which thou hast not known, and let us serve them; Thou shalt not hearken unto the words of that prophet, or that dreamer of dreams: for the LORD your God proveth you, to know whether ye love the LORD your God with all your heart and with all your soul.” The Word is not ignorant of the fact that signs and wonders can occur but warns that you had better discern between “Even him, whose coming is after the working of Satan with all power and signs and lying wonders” (2 Thessalonians 2:9).
That which is of the Holy Ghost is and always will be Christ centered; it decreases man and increases Jesus. There is nothing innocent about false doctrine and false prophets! At the very root of what they are and teach is an exaltation of man. It is man centered and it is not of the Lord—truly a non-profit organization!

DENY YOURSELF
Matthew 16:24
What does Jesus mean when he says, “You must deny yourself?” Does he mean that we are to reach way down and run the extra mile when we do not feel it is possible, or perhaps deny ourselves an extra trip to the buffet bar? Maybe he is talking about rising early in the morning to pray, thus denying that extra hour of sleep we need. I believe all of these may be the end result of the interpretation of what it means to deny ourselves, but the truth is, men have done all of these things and never once done it with anything but natural strength.
If you really look at what is meant by taking up your cross, you will see that the invitation is to do the impossible. The cross meant absolute death—how is a dead man going to follow anyone? The answer is only by faith in the resurrection power of Jesus Christ: Jesus did not die alone, neither was he resurrected alone—He included us.
To deny ourselves therefore must mean that we have an attitude of complete dependency on the person of Jesus Christ; we must not lean on any supposed strength of our own. It means to recognize what we can and can not do. If I was to ask you to read Matthew 16:24, you would have no trouble doing so. However, if I was to ask you to tell and interpret the dream President Obama will have two years from now, you would “deny yourself” and claim it is impossible. If I was to ask you to float down a raging river, you could do that; if I asked you to make the raging river to flow UP a mountain, you would “deny yourself.”
When it comes to living a life pleasing to God, we must once and for all realize that it is ONLY in Christ living in us that this is possible! We must deny any self righteous attitude that allows us to think we can defy the scriptures that teach, that apart from him, we can do nothing. After all, it is much more possible to turn a raging river upstream than it is to live a spiritual life leaning on mere human strength. Jesus come live in me!!
